2010-02-11 6 views

risposta

15

Sembra che la grafica non venga caricata correttamente. Per impostazione predefinita, l'interfaccia utente di jQuery prevede che la cartella con le immagini sia una sottocartella della cartella in cui si trova il file css. Utilizza uno strumento come firebug (scheda "Rete") per rilevare le richieste per l'immagine con le frecce e vedere quale URL tenta di caricarlo.

+0

Sì David Hedlund ha funzionato su di me, grazie –

+0

Grazie. Non mi ero nemmeno reso conto che jquery-ui aveva una cartella di immagini. Ho appena avuto la sceneggiatura e il css. –

1

Mi sono imbattuto in questo problema.

Quello che ho fatto è stato, ho appena scaricato nuovamente il tema. Si è scoperto che le immagini nella mia cartella tematica erano danneggiate.

+0

Inoltre ho effettuato nuovamente il download e non ho avuto problemi – Benjamin

2

Sembra che il tema non sia completo, assicurati di caricare correttamente l'opzione di modifica del mese.

$(".date").datepicker({ changeMonth: true }); 

o

$(".date").datepicker("option", "changeMonth", true); 

e controllare il CSS è l'Essere trovato correttamente, è possibile utilizzare Firebug per ispezionare i file chiamati e non si trova nella scheda "NET"

2

Risposta breve. Non hai caricato le immagini fornite dal tema ui jquery. apri la console in chrome o firefox, dove ti verrà detto quali immagini e dove dovresti mettere le tue immagini.

0

Sto avendo un problema simile. Posso cambiare i mesi, ma le frecce non sono visibili. anche se do uno stile all'interno della pagina per sovrascrivere. Strano, perché lavorano su altre pagine.

<style type='text/css'> 
ui-icon ui-icon-circle-triangle-e {z-index:9999 !important; position:absolute} 
</style> 
0

se si va a Chrome o FF e utilizzare l'ispettore vi dirà quale immagine ha bisogno di essere lì. L'elemento si presenta così

<span class="ui-icon ui-icon-circle-triangle-w"> 

    Prev 

</span> 

la regola CSS simile a questa

background-image: url("images/ui-icons_d8e7f3_256x240.png"); 
} 

Come accennato, la scheda di rete è un ottimo posto per vedere quale le immagini non vengono caricati.

L'unico risultato è che l'url è relativo al file js. Fare clic su una delle 404 immagini e non sarà l'URL di richiesta in alto. Nota che l'url è relativo al file JS, quindi se hai una cartella di immagini fuori dalla radice, mettere le immagini non ti aiuterà molto. copia la cartella immagini dal file zip scaricato e inseriscila nella cartella js. questo ha risolto il problema per me.

Ho letto il documento per ChangeMonth come se facessi qualcosa di diverso. Non penso che risolverà il problema indicato qui. http://api.jqueryui.com/datepicker/#option-changeMonth